THAMES CENTRE - Five people had to be taken to hospital after a three vehicle crash on Highway 401 in Thames Centre.
Police say two pickup trucks were waiting to merge into a construction zone, when they were rear ended by an eastbound SUV at around 8:00 a.m. on Friday.
A 48-year-old man from London was taken to hospital, along with four Wisconsin men who were 19 and 20. All of the injuries were non-life threatening and the crash closed all of the eastbound lanes of the highway for about two hours.
